Sunclub Salou Apartments
Salou
Costa Dorada
Star Rating: 4 Star
Telephone: Unknown
Number Of Rooms: 112 apartments
Number Of Floors: 6
Number Of Lifts: 2
What The Brochures Say:
First Choice Summer 2004
The Sunclub Salou is located in a quiet area of the family resort of Cap Salou. The complex offers a good standard of accommodation and a selection of activities. Both the beach and a range of shops and restaurants are only a short walk away.

We booked the Sunclub purely based on First Choices brochure description, in particular with regard the kids club and baby sitting availability. When we got there we found there was no baby sitting available and the kids club was only on for a round 2-3 max per day/night. The brochure did clearly detail kids club times as a guide only but it basically listed activites all day and night. 3 hours is a little far off to be ignored.
Another little moan our kids did not get the kids club outfits until the 12th day!

Other than that the Appts were spotless, we actually has a maid in daily. Food in the hotel was dire. No big deal just 2 mins walk and there are plenty of eating joints around, all better value.

The Sunclub is actually in Cap Salou about 20-30 mins walk with kids or 5 mins on the bus but the drivers charge you for little ones as per adults. Costs were 1.20 euro for the bus.

Staff were all very friendly, there is a Geordie women on reception who was fluent in Spanish....very helpful.

Entertainment again was very poor. It consisted of Bingo, Water Polo in the day. Repeated every day! At night they managed two decent nights out of the fourteen with external entertainers coming otherwise it's. Bingo, The Peg Game and a couple of songs for the kids.

The pool is absoultely freezing, really puts you off getting in. This is due to the fact that the Sun does not get onto the pool untils 12:00 - 13:00 and it has little time to warm up! It is also absolutely mobbed with dive bombers, water fighters etc. I suppose to be expected being a family appts. A little to much though!
Next with the pool. There is a tight time scale for opening: 10:00-18:00. You can't go near it any earlier than 10 in the morning and its closed sharpish at 6 every day! Never experienced this before!

Last one there is not enough beds. If you are not queing for 09:45, then you will not get a bed by the pool!!! Simply not enough beds! We suffered with towels being moved etc and rows over beds, not much fun!!

Just came back from these brand new apartments. 30 minutes from the airport. Very clean indeed, cleaners are seen throughout the day all around this complex. Apartments very spacious with a built-in hairdryer in the bathroom and a microwave in the kitchen area with basic cooking facilities and fridge. Entertainment every night including a kid's funtime. A quiz every night and also HAPPY HOUR at the bar 8pm - 9pm. Buy one get one FREE !

There is a varied menu on offer from breakfast to evening meals. Do try the local pub The Paddock - great portions and reasonable price. People always outside disappointed that there are no tables available - particularly around 7pm. I recommend eating there and also close-by The Smugglers is another good place to eat. ( Five mins walk away from the apartments.) Taxis to the centre of Salou around 4 Euros - The fountain is the best place to be dropped off and a taxi rank is there for the return journey. Too far to walk. Bus will cost you 1 Euro and are pretty full indeed. The beach is very crowded so just before the Paddock Pub in Cap Salou there is a lovely small sandy cove which is very popular and you can hire sunbeds there. It is a downhill walk, but take your time going back up !!!! The pool in these apartments is supervised by a Lifeguard and water polo for the kids is also supervised. Kid's Club everyday .


Very hot in Salou - plenty of suncream required. Late check out also available from these apartments. Do try the Aquapark (Aquapolis) in La Pineda. Brill day out - 10 mins away on the bus . Bus stop opposite side of the road to the apartments. They cater for the very small children too.

These apartments opened in May 2002 and we travelled to them later that month. Our one bedroom apartment was large with excellent storage space. Both the rooms and public areas were very clean. The staff were very helpful throughout our stay. Any problems were quickly attended to.There is a 90 Euro deposit for the room. A room safe is 25 Euro per week including a 10 Euro deposit.

There is a medium size pool which is very clean and has a lifeguard on duty. Children are not allowed lilos in the pool.There is a terrace with free sunbeds.Due to the position of the building the sun does not reach the terrace or pool until about 11am. This leaves the pool very cold until mid afternoon.

The apartments have their own small shop and a large bar/entertainment area. The bar area can be very noisey in the evenings.

Cap Salou is a small village with a supermarket, a souvener shop, some bars and a small beach. Try the Paddock bar especially for food.

The bus to Salou runs every 30 mins from the main road but better to take a taxi costing about 5 euro for the 5 minute journey as the buses are always full.

Overall this is an excellent complex particularly if you want a quiet base with busy Salou nearby
